Transaction f770efec72f3dd8fa099de5b96955220bda90fbbd72e5bdb1b08c98fff083b15

7 Input
2 Outputs
  • f770efec72f3dd8fa099de5b96955220bda90fbbd72e5bdb1b08c98fff083b15:0
  • value  17758666
    address  3G6B2pWZANsoTjRK6G5jFdRuwCfPZ5QjPc
  • f770efec72f3dd8fa099de5b96955220bda90fbbd72e5bdb1b08c98fff083b15:1
  • value  2103095
    address  bc1qqc6x3p4578ezq6ldytr275gkj3vtgg48u3lnny